he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) on Tuesday launched the second set of promises for the February 5 Delhi assembly polls with the launching of 'Sankalp Patra' Part 2. BJP Lok Sabha MP Anurag Thakur launched the Sankalp Patra in the presence of other senior BJP leaders from Delhi.

Slamming Lok Sabha LoP Rahul Gandhi for calling the Bihar caste census 'fake,' JDU leader Rajiv Ranjan Prasad on Saturday said that he must speak about his party's tenure of 55 years and tell what they did for reservation and regarding the caste census.
Speaking at the 'Samvidhan Suraksha Sammelan' in Patna, the Congress MP said, "Caste census should be conducted to understand the true situation of the nation. It will not be like the fake caste census that has been conducted in Bihar...A policy should be made based on the caste census...
